Won 120k then lost it all by SignificantMark52545 in GamblingAddiction

[–]Miserablepunts 7 points8 points  (0 children)

I had a similar story 2 years ago. I deposited 1k aud, ran it up to a bit over 100k at the peak. Even withdrew most of it at some point. This 100k was close to or just a bit over what I had lost since I started gambling.

I ended up losing 95% of it in 2 weeks.

After that I managed to lay off gambling for 3 months, but have been on and off since then and losing 1-2k pretty much every month.

Learn your lesson here and stop gambling. There is no end to this. You win and you want more, you lose and you want to recover the losses. Only QUIT ALL TOGETHER cold turkey.

Blocking crypto transactions by prickle274 in GamblingAddiction

[–]Miserablepunts 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Gambling block on aus banks only works for aus bookies like ladbrokes, tab etc. For crypto sites you’d need to go gamban or maybe change the 2fa on crypto platform so only you can authorise the crypto transaction? Could maybe ask ANZ to block all crypto related payments too

I lost $53,000 in 24 hours by helpmejoelf in problemgambling

[–]Miserablepunts 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Similarly, last year I won around 70k usd (on 50k/yr income) from $700, proceeded to lose most of that within a short period of time. Multiple 10k+ bets during that time. Just like you, I was so devastated and promised myself to never touch gambling again. Time goes by, I didn’t gamble for 3-4months (longest since I started gambling), bank balance, mental state, life in general was better than ever. But I slipped up in feb. Lost everything and since then it’s been really hard to control my urges especially when I get paid. My only advice is do everything you can to stay away from gambling and get the fuck out of this hell hole. GA, gamban, community group, find a hobby or whatever. Once you experience the big win/loss with big bets relative to your income, your gambling brain is pretty much fucked. Don’t go chasing that big “win” or you’ll keep digging a bigger hole
